Rainbow Six Siege is celebrating its 10th anniversary with a limited‑time playlist called Wildcards Siege. The event centers on round‑by‑round rule twists that the community selects mid‑match, directly reshaping the flow of each fight. It is live now and runs through January 5. Matches are played on the reworked House map at dusk, a deliberate nod to Siege’s early days. Ubisoft frames the modifiers as throwbacks to the game’s history, tuned so both teams face an equal challenge.

How Wildcards Siege works

Wildcards Siege uses Bomb mode in a best‑of‑five format. At the end of every round, all players see a set of possible modifiers and each player gets one vote. The top two modifiers with the most votes are then applied to the next round, changing team compositions, information flow, or even core controls.

  • Multi‑pick – allows duplicate Operator selections (for example, multiple Kapkans on one team).
  • Tactical Realism – a throwback ruleset that strips HUD elements for a more immersive feel.
  • Operator restrictions – limits picks to specific squads (e.g., Redhammer) for focused line‑ups.
  • Weapon rules – forces all players to use a particular weapon type.
  • Reversed movement inputs – a tongue‑in‑cheek nod to a past bug, adjusted to ensure fairness.

These options aim to keep every round unpredictable, pushing teams to adapt strategies on the fly while maintaining competitive parity.

House at dusk – a deliberate throwback

All matches take place on House at dusk. House was the first map shown when Siege debuted at E3 2014 and has since been significantly reworked. The dusk setting adds a nostalgic lens to the modern layout, pairing legacy vibes with current‑day level design.

Dates and format

The event is available for a limited window and runs through January 5. Wildcards Siege uses the standard Bomb objective with best‑of‑five rounds, but the vote‑driven modifiers ensure no two rounds play out the same.

Key takeaways for players

The headline feature is the player‑voted modifier system – a simple mechanic that radically reshapes tactics round to round. Expect to juggle information scarcity under Tactical Realism one moment and composition chaos under Multi‑pick the next, all on a familiar map with fresh pacing.
